<title>32004 FIRE WARNING EQUIPMENT FOR DWELLING UNITS</title>
<description>32004 DESCRIPTION:
Have basic understanding of fire warning equipment for dwelling units, its required protection, power supplies, performance, spacing and location of detectors and alarm sounding devices. (NFPA 72)
